Why Pick Outpatient Substance Abuse Treatment Facility in Hardyville, Virginia?

If you have been abusing mind-altering and illegal drugs for some time, it is very likely that you may have developed tolerance to and dependence on these drugs. In such a situation, an outpatient substance abuse treatment center may help you overcome all the problems associated with your substance abuse.

Hardyville outpatient treatment may not always be realistic when you are attempting to rid alcohol and/or drugs from your body. For this, you need specialized detox services that are often provided on an inpatient or residential basis.

After you overcome your physical dependence, you may find that out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ation works well and that it is the most viable form of addiction treatment. At this stage, you will be physically well enough that you won't require around the clock medical care and assistance.

Today, supportive programs like intensive outpatient treatment and partial hospitalization have assisted many people beat their addictions without having to invest a great deal of time and money to find sobriety.

However, you should still remember that every addict's journey of recovery is different. As such, the level of care and supervision you might need should only be decided by qualified medical personnel.

That said, an outpatient substance abuse treatment facility in Hardyville, VA. is part and parcel of an extensive continuum of rehabilitation and supervision that can help you start working towards long-term sobriety. The advantage of such a facility is that you will still be able to continue most of your daily routines. You can even resume working and only go for treatment at the rehab center in the evening.

Overall, outpatient drug treatment is among the best types of addiction treatment available today. Through these programs, you will learn how to switch back to your daily life while still working towards achieving sobriety and overcoming your addiction. You will also have a safety net comprised of understanding friends at the treatment facility and beyond to guarantee that you do not relapse.
